The Weatherby Mark V Live Wild is a lightweight backcountry bolt-action rifle built on the Mark V action and developed in partnership with Remi Warren. It pairs a spiral-fluted, threaded barrel with an Accubrake ST muzzle device and an externally adjustable TriggerTech trigger for precise shot control. The barreled action is finished for element resistance and is mounted in a hand-painted black and grey polymer stock designed for ergonomic handling.
Key Specifications
- The rifle is chambered in 6.5 Weatherby RPM for modern field performance.
- The action is a Bolt action built on Weatherby Mark V multi-lug architecture.
- The unloaded weight is approximately 5.80 lbs for backcountry maneuverability.
- The magazine configuration provides a 4 + 1 capacity.
- The barrel is spiral-fluted and threaded to accept 1/2×28 muzzle accessories.
- The muzzle device is a Accubrake ST to help manage recoil impulse.
- The trigger is a TriggerTech adjustable trigger with an externally adjustable pull range of 2.5–5 lb.
- The receiver is drilled and tapped for scope mounting.
- The stock is a fixed polymer forend with a hand-painted black and grey sponge pattern and aluminum pillar construction.
- The barrel thread pattern is 1/2×28.
